Four people including prayer leader killed in Kabul

Four people including Azizullah Mofleh, a prayer leader, were killed and ten others were wounded in an explosion which went off at a mosque in western Kabul, the Afghan ministry of interior says.

The explosion took place during the Friday prayer at Shershah Sori mosque in Kart-e-4 neighborhood of Kabul, according to security sources.   

No group has claimed responsibility.

The deadly explosion follows by a blast which killed Mohammad Ayaz Niazi, an imam, at Wazir Akbar Khan mosque on June 02.
